Mineral: | Schorl Tourmaline in Muscovite |
Locality: | north ridge of Long Hill, Haddam, Middlesex County, Connecticut |
Description: | Lustrous black 45 mm schorl tourmaline crystal in silvery muscovite mica with two other partial crystals of schorl in the sides. The main schorl crystal is terminated, through one corner has muscovite inclusions that interrupted growth. Collected in 1993 |
Overall Size: | 6x3.5x3.5 cm |
Crystals: | 45 mm |
